WILHELM EMANUEL BEHM
Wilhelm Behm, Fall Landscape, with Lake and Hilly Nature Surroundings

About the Item

A beautiful Swedish autumn landscape on a sunny day with a lake and a large birch tree in focus surrounded by a hilly landscape and vegetation painted by Wilhelm Emanuel Behm (1859-1934). It is signed "Wilh. Behm" and dated 1887. The frame is original and in good condition. It might feel too heavy in the taste of today but can easily be changed. Behm was a Swedish artist and studied at the Royal Fine Arts Academy in Stockholm 1879–1885 and in Paris 1889–1890. He joined the plein-air realism of the 1880s and shows in his early works a fine, blond value painting like in our painting. Later, Behm connects with the national romanticism of the 1890s, and his art takes on a stronger mood and a deeper color, preferably copper-red. He preferably depicted the middle Swedish landscape, especially in spring break and twilight light. Among his works are "Vinterdag" (winter day) at the National Museum and "Marsafton" (Mars evening) at the Gothenburg Art Museum. He is also represented in the National Museum in Stockholm with a number of paintings. Norrköping Art Museum also have his works. He was described at his death as belonging to "the old-fashioned and solid school of landscape art" and a "perfect representative of realistic plein-air painting" who did not allow himself to be influenced by the many new trends in art during the latter part of his life. Nevertheless, in his membership of the Art Academy since 1910, he showed an idealistic faith in the development of art and interest in the young people whose art was so different from his - a testimony to the motto "Ars longa, vita brevis" ("Art is long, life is short") .     A female and male Goosander bird on ice floes. In the center of the painting there is a smaller opening in the ice covered waters. This painting, by Christian Berg (1893-1976) is quite interesting and unusual for his works. It is signed "Ch. Berg" and dated 1918. Berg is mostly famous for his sculptures which was to become his signum works later in his life. He is known primarily for his abstract artworks. He was educated at the Technical School and Althin's painting school in Stockholm 1911–1914. In the years 1914–1917 he studied at the Royal Academy of Fine Arts and started with animal painting in the spirit of Bruno Liljefors. Our painting is from this period just after he finished his studies at the Royal Academy of Fine Arts. In 1921, he studied in Berlin and Dresden which was followed by a trip to Egypt in 1925. In the same year he moved to Paris and had a studio on rue Guénégaud. He studied with André Lhote and his interest in cubism was awakened.
